1. Understanding Burnouts: More Than Just Smoke

A burnout in a car is more than just spinning the tires and creating a cloud of smoke. It’s a deliberate act of overcoming the tire’s grip on the road surface, causing it to spin rapidly while the vehicle remains relatively stationary. This is achieved by applying significant power to the wheels while simultaneously restraining the vehicle’s movement, usually through the brakes. It’s a spectacle of controlled power, but it’s important to understand both the allure and the potential consequences.

1.1. The Science Behind the Smoke

The billowing smoke that characterizes a burnout is a result of the intense friction between the spinning tire and the road surface. This friction generates heat, causing the tire’s rubber to vaporize and release the characteristic white or black smoke. The type of smoke depends on the tire compound and the road surface.

1.2. A Brief History of Burnouts

The origins of burnouts are intertwined with the history of drag racing. Racers initially used burnouts as a practical way to heat up their tires before a race. Warmer tires provide better grip, leading to improved acceleration off the starting line. Over time, burnouts evolved from a practical necessity into a crowd-pleasing spectacle.

3. Mastering the Technique: How to Do a Burnout Safely (and Legally)

If you’re determined to experience a burnout, it’s crucial to do so safely and legally. This means finding a controlled environment, understanding the proper techniques, and taking necessary precautions.

3.1. Finding a Safe and Legal Location

The first and most important step is to find a safe and legal location. This could be a designated area at a racetrack, a private property with the owner’s permission, or a sanctioned event. Never attempt a burnout on public roads or in parking lots.

3.2. Preparing Your Vehicle

Before attempting a burnout, ensure your vehicle is in good condition. Check tire pressure, brake functionality, and fluid levels. It’s also a good idea to remove any loose items from the car that could become projectiles.

3.3. Burnout Techniques for Manual Transmissions

Performing a burnout in a manual transmission car requires coordination and finesse. Here’s a step-by-step guide:

  1. Engage the clutch: Fully depress the clutch pedal with your left foot.
  2. Select first gear: Shift the gear lever into first gear.
  3. Rev the engine: Use your right foot to rev the engine to around 3,000-4,000 RPM. This is a starting point; you may need to adjust based on your car’s power and gearing.
  4. Release the clutch and apply the brakes: Quickly release the clutch while simultaneously applying the brakes with your right foot. The goal is to allow the tires to spin while preventing the car from moving forward.
  5. Modulate the throttle and brakes: Use the throttle and brakes to control the wheel spin. Too much throttle will cause the car to move forward, while too much brake will stall the engine.
  6. Enjoy the smoke (briefly): Once the tires are spinning and the smoke is billowing, maintain a steady throttle and brake pressure. Don’t hold the burnout for too long, as this can damage your tires and drivetrain.

3.4. Burnout Techniques for Automatic Transmissions

Performing a burnout in an automatic transmission car is generally easier, but still requires caution:

  1. Engage the brakes: Firmly apply the brakes with your left foot.
  2. Select drive: Shift the gear lever into drive.
  3. Rev the engine: Use your right foot to rev the engine. The transmission will resist the engine’s power, preventing the car from moving forward initially.
  4. Modulate the throttle: Gradually increase the throttle until the tires start to spin. Be careful not to over-rev the engine.
  5. Release the brakes slightly: Once the tires are spinning, slightly release the brakes to allow the wheels to spin freely.
  6. Enjoy the smoke (briefly): Maintain a steady throttle and brake pressure. As with manual transmissions, avoid holding the burnout for too long.

4. The Impact on Your Car: What Happens When You Do a Burnout?

Burnouts put a tremendous amount of stress on your car’s components. Understanding the potential damage can help you make informed decisions and minimize the risks.

4.1. Tire Wear and Tear

The most obvious consequence of a burnout is tire wear. The intense friction rapidly wears down the tire tread, significantly reducing its lifespan. In severe cases, burnouts can cause tire blowouts.

4.2. Brake Damage

Burnouts require using the brakes to restrain the car while the tires spin. This generates a lot of heat in the braking system, which can lead to brake fade, warped rotors, and worn-out brake pads.

4.3. Drivetrain Stress

The drivetrain, which includes the transmission, driveshaft, and differential, is subjected to immense stress during a burnout. This can lead to premature wear and tear, and in extreme cases, can cause component failure.

4.4. Engine Strain

Revving the engine to high RPMs during a burnout puts extra strain on the engine’s internal components. This can lead to increased wear and tear, and potentially, engine damage.

4.5. Suspension Stress

The suspension system absorbs the shock and vibration from the spinning tires and the car’s movement. This can lead to worn-out shocks, struts, and other suspension components.

4.6. Potential for Overheating

The combination of high engine RPMs and limited airflow can cause the engine to overheat during a burnout. Overheating can lead to serious engine damage.

15. Advanced Techniques for Controlled Burnouts

For experienced drivers seeking to refine their burnout skills, advanced techniques can enhance control and precision.

15.1. Using a Line Lock

A line lock is a device that allows you to lock the front brakes independently of the rear brakes. This enables you to perform burnouts more easily and with greater control.

15.2. Featherting the Throttle and Brake

Feathering the throttle and brake involves making small, precise adjustments to maintain optimal wheel spin and prevent stalling.

15.3. Maintaining Consistent Wheel Speed

The key to a smooth, controlled burnout is maintaining a consistent wheel speed. This requires careful coordination of the throttle and brake.

18. Exploring The Different Types of Burnouts

There are many different types of burnouts, all with their own methods and styles.

18.1. Stationary Burnouts

Stationary burnouts involve keeping the car in one place while spinning the tires.

18.2. Rolling Burnouts

Rolling burnouts involve spinning the tires while the car is moving at a slow speed.

18.3. Water Box Burnouts

Water box burnouts are typically performed at drag strips. They involve wetting the tires to reduce traction and make it easier to spin them.

20. Frequently Asked Questions (FAQs) About Burnouts

Here are some frequently asked questions about burnouts:

20.1. Is it possible to do a burnout with a front-wheel drive car?

Yes, but it’s more difficult and less visually impressive. You’ll need to use the parking brake to lock the rear wheels while applying the throttle.

20.2. How can I prevent my car from stalling during a burnout?

Make sure you have enough revs before releasing the clutch (manual transmission) or applying the throttle (automatic transmission). Feather the throttle and brake to maintain wheel spin without bogging down the engine.

20.3. What is the best way to clean up after a burnout?

Use a broom and a hose to remove any tire debris and rubber marks from the pavement. You may also need to use a degreaser to remove stubborn stains.

20.4. Can burnouts damage my car’s computer system?

While unlikely, burnouts can potentially trigger error codes or damage sensors if the engine is over-revved or overheated.

20.5. Are there any car insurance policies that cover burnout-related damage?

Most car insurance policies do not cover damage caused by intentional acts like burnouts.

20.6. How often should I replace my tires if I do burnouts regularly?

If you do burnouts regularly, you may need to replace your tires much more frequently than normal. Inspect your tires regularly for signs of wear and replace them as needed.

20.7. Can I do a burnout on wet pavement?

Yes, but it will be more difficult to control and may increase the risk of losing control of your vehicle.

20.8. Are there any apps that can help me track my burnout performance?

Yes, there are several apps that can track your car’s speed, acceleration, and wheel spin during a burnout.

20.9. What are the signs that my car is overheating during a burnout?

Signs of overheating include a rising temperature gauge, steam coming from under the hood, and a burning smell.
